What are intramuscular injections?

Why IM Shots?

Intramuscular (IM) injections deliver vitamins, amino acids, and antioxidants directly into muscle tissue for rapid absorption and faster results than oral supplements. Whether you’re low on energy, recovering from a workout, feeling under the weather, or simply maintaining your wellness routine, IM shots are a quick and effective solution.

FAQ

Are the INtramuscular injections painful?

No, most of the injections are not painful. There are a few nutrients that are known to sting a little more than others, however, your nurse will know exactly which ones those are and will warn you ahead of time. 

How long does it take?

IM shots are quicker (less than a minute), go into the muscle (not a vein), and don’t require a drip bag. They offer fast absorption and are great for targeted nutrient boosts.

How long do the benefits last?

Benefits can last days to weeks, depending on your metabolism, nutrient status, and lifestyle.

Are IM shots safe?

Yes—when administered by trained professionals with proper medical screening.

Are the dosages the same as I would get in the IV?

Yes, the intramuscular injection nutrients are the same dose for the nutrients that are offered IV as well. 

How long does it take to work?

Effects are often felt within 15–60 minutes, depending on the nutrient and your current deficiency levels.

Where are the intramuscular injections given?

Common sites are the deltoid (upper arm) or glute (hip).

Can I get an IM shot and IV drip in the same visit?

Yes—many clients combine them for a more comprehensive boost.
